Hi, yes I have been having issues since the FortiClientVPN 7.4.5 update. My post below details my problem:

https://www.reddit.com/r/fortinet/comments/1jec702/forticlient_appears_to_be_interrupting_internet/

We are also using Entra/SAML auth as well. For whatever reason, the connection seems to break during the 2FA process for us. Even when using Passkeys in authenticator on another device, the login screen reports Bluetooth is not working properly, but funnily that error only pops up after I scan the code and the other mobile device attempts to talk to the authenticating device.

For push notifications, Authenticator app reports "No internet connection". . and Internet seems to be broken (web browsing doesn't work) for the whole phone. We have either close FortiClient, or restart the phone. This ONLY happens after attempting to connect FortiClient on the iOS device. We are an all apple shop for mobile devices, so I can't comment on Android.

Help with CA policies to allow security registration from untrusted networks with a TAP only by psgrn in sysadmin

[–]psgrn[S] 2 points3 points  (0 children)

It's funny, I spend hours trying to figure it out, but a combination of typing out my problem, and seeing a reply as simple as yours and the light bulb goes on.

My problem was setting a blanket block policy on untrusted networks, thinking I needed that on top of a grant policy with TAP - like a firewall implicit deny. But, CA was selecting the most restrictive policy to apply when on untrusted networks. So, like you said, I have two policies, one for when on trusted networks (allowing any of our supported MFA methods), and another allow on untrusted but with TAP only. The third policy is not needed as the block will happen automatically on untrusted via the second policy because they didn't authenticate with a TAP.
